    Does Adguard's VPN still allow my ISP to see my real IP address?

    Currently I am using stealth mode and have the WFP network driver enabled.
    Thanks
     
  2. avatar

    avatar Developer

    Joined:
    Jan 18, 2014
    Posts:
    1,048
    But there's no Adguard VPN. If you're talking about "Hide IP address" feature of the stealth mode, it just tries to trick websites into thinking, that you have different IP. It does not actually route your traffic through a VPN.
